Taxonomic Classification

Rank Blue-Girdled Webcap Eastern Mole Vole
Kingdom Fungi (Fungi)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Basidiomycota (Club Fungi)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Agaricales (Gilled Mushrooms)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Cortinariaceae Cricetidae
Genus Cortinarius Ellobius
Species Cortinarius collinitus Ellobius tancrei

Blue-Girdled Webcap

The Blue Girdled Webcap (Cortinarius collinitus) is a species in the genus Cortinarius.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in forest floors, decomposing wood, and soil ecosystems.
